Definitions

辛 xīn
  1. 1. (of taste) hot or pungent
  2. 2. laborious
  3. 3. suffering
  4. 4. hard
  5. 5. eighth of the ten Heavenly Stems shí tiān gān
  6. 6. eighth in order
  7. 7. surname Xin
  8. 8. letter "H" or Roman "VIII" in list "A, B, C", or "I, II, III" etc
  9. 9. ancient Chinese compass point: 285°
  10. 10. octa
